What about this: Any number fewer than __ hours, is not a day of work?

Nordin

I don’t count the hours, it’s all the time. It’s something that’s always growing inside of me and then it grows even more when I let it out.

I am incredibly fascinated by the process—how thoughts, compositions, and stories emerge, how an empty canvas or paper can become worlds I did not even know existed before. Everything is possible: one form meets another, then becomes a basis for new forms to build on. The feeling in a line or a color changes in the meeting with another. Different compositions are built up and lead me forward. It’s a curiosity that drives me. And the deeper I go, the more I discover. It’s an infinite space that just keeps growing. I think it’s amazing how I can do something over and over again, day after day, and yet always have more to discover and learn.

(Actually it’s always such a weird thought when I begin to think that this is what I do for work. It’s such a dream to just do what comes naturally and what I love to do, and at the same time being able to make a living on it — I’m very thankful.)
